The Telangana State Engineering, Agriculture and Medical Common Entrance Test (TS EAMCET) 2022 will be conducted on July 14, 15, 18, 19 and 20.
While the entrance test for agriculture is scheduled for July 14 and 15, the test for admissions into various engineering courses is on July 18, 19 and 20. Similarly, the Telangana State Engineering Common Entrance Test (TS ECET) 2022 will be held on July 13, Education Minister P Sabitha Indra Reddy said here on Tuesday.
These common entrance tests would be conducted in 105 exam centres in 23 regional centres, the Minister said, adding that registration fee and other details would be announced in the detailed notifications by common entrance tests conveners.
Officials said the TS EAMCET 2022 would be conducted covering 70 per cent of the intermediate syllabus. This decision was taken as the Telangana State Board of Intermediate Education had decided to hold inter public exams covering 70 per cent of the total syllabus as enough physical classes could not be conducted during the academic year 2021-22 due to the Covid-19 pandemic.
The aggregate marks in the intermediate for admissions into various courses through the TS EAMCET 2022 are likely to be relaxed to ‘pass’ in intermediate. As per rule, 45 per cent (40 per cent for SC/ST category) of marks is a must for admission. However, this norm is likely to be relaxed as all second-year students were passed considering their first-year scores and second-year students who had backlogs in the first year were given minimum qualifying marks in 2021 as exams could not be held due to the pandemic.
This apart, as a low pass percentage was registered by second-year students in the first-year exams held during 2021-22, the government had granted minimum qualifying marks to all failed students in these exams. Telangana EAMCET from July 14
The Telangana State Engineering, Agriculture and Medical Common Entrance Test (TS EAMCET) 2022 will be conducted on July 14, 15, 18, 19 and 20 with several concessions given to students in terms of syllabus and marks.
The notification with all the details would be released soon by the Convenor, Minister for Education P. Sabitha Indra Reddy said here on Tuesday.
The entrance test for the agriculture stream will be held on July 14 and 15 while the test for engineering courses will be held on July 18, 19 and 20. The tests would be conducted in 105 exam centres in 23 regional centres.
The government has decided to give concessions in the syllabus with only 70% of the Intermediate syllabus to be covered in the entrance exam. The Board of Intermediate Education (BIE) has already taken a decision to conduct its annual examinations with 70% of the syllabus only as regular classes could not be held this year due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
Officials said all the students who pass the Intermediate exam will be eligible for admissions into the professional courses as the government has decided to waive the 45% mandatory score in Intermediate as the major eligibility criteria. For SC and ST students it was 40%.
However, all the students who pass the exam with minimum marks will be eligible for admission based on the EAMCET rank. This is being done as the government has decided to pass all the candidates who failed in the first year and were promoted to the second year with minimum marks irrespective of the score they secured in the examinations held.
Similarly, the EAMCET rank will be decided only on the marks secured in the entrance exam as the 25% weightage for Intermediate marks in the calculation of ranks has also been waived for this year.
Generally, the process of EAMCET begins in March and April and is completed with the announcement of results in June every year. But due to COVID-19, the schedule has gone haywire as the Intermediate exams are being held in May this year. Moreover, officials also have to ensure that the exam dates don’t clash with JEE or other national level entrance exams that are taken by the state students.
Thousands of students from Telangana also appear for the tests conducted by the deemed universities and private universities. So a lot of care has to be taken while deciding on the dates. The availability of online test slots is also important as the slots are outsourced.
